If you're downloading it from the Yahoo website you might be having a prob with the installer. Their website downloads a small .exe file that will then automatically open and begin downloading and installing at the same time. You could try just downloading the entire file, and then clicking the file to begin installation. You can get the file here: http://www.filehippo.com/download_yahoo_messenger/download/ae5802426a2721992104febeee480b4c/ Be sure to click the "download latest version" link at the top of the page to get version 9 (instead of an older version).
Good luck, Donk PS: if it still hangs then you might have a prob with your security settings not wanting to let you download a .exe file. Try reducing the security settings in the browser you are using and/or temporarily disabling your anti-virus apps.
